    Major attractions are popping up along Route 66 across the country and Tulsa is jumping on board with the development of the Palmera Motor Court. The retro-inspired hotel is being designed right here in Tulsa by Studio 45 Architects. Katie Huisenga with Studio 45 gives us the inside scoop on the new hotel and how she got into architecture as a child.

    Remi Matheson is a beautiful 8-year-old Owasso girl with a rare genetic mutation called Angelman Syndrome. Remi's parents, Chrysti and Derek Matheson host an annual golf tournament, called the Remi Cup to help raise money for Angelman Syndrome research. The Mathesons talk about the characteristics and early signs of the disorder and tell us all about their little firecracker, Remi.     Raittia Rogers started out living a life of crime and recklessness as a teenager. That life soon landed her in jail. After spending time behind bars, Rogers decided prison life was not for her and spent the rest of her sentence taking advantage of reform programs and leaning on her faith. Rogers has written a book called "I Broke Out of Prison" and tells her success story. Rogers shares with us her struggles with a troubled childhood and how she overcame prison and started a new life.     Many Oklahoma families struggle to find the help and the resources their children need when it comes to therapy. Kristin Tipps with 9 Ranch uses the power of nature and alternative methods to help children open up and share their feelings. Kristin tells us how she uses natural components like sand therapy, play therapy, and even fishing to help kids heal.
